Queensland Premier Campbell Newman has unveiled the “Queensland Globe,” expected to better inform taxpayers and provide business opportunities. But the computer program’s reliance on multiple government data sets and plans for the release of previously classified information has raised privacy concerns. Newman says, however, that protecting the public’s privacy is paramount. “No private information will be released. We’ll be working with the privacy commissioner to ensure that the use of multiple data sources doesn’t inadvertently pinpoint one individual,” he says, adding “information is indeed the new currency,” and open data can help businesses gain the information they need to develop commercial applications.
